Current Trends on Vad Kostar Nytt Kök

When it comes to kitchen renovation, the trends are constantly evolving. One of the current trends that we’ve been seeing in Sweden is the use of natural materials such as wood, stone, and marble. These materials not only give the kitchen a warm and natural feel but also add value to the property. Another trend is the use of smart technology, such as touchless faucets, smart ovens, and induction cooktops. These technologies not only make cooking easier but also save energy and reduce water wastage.

Question & Answer and FAQs

Q: How much does a kitchen renovation cost in Sweden?

A: The cost of a kitchen renovation in Sweden depends on various factors such as the size of the kitchen, the materials used, and the complexity of the project. On average, a kitchen renovation in Sweden can cost anywhere from 50,000 SEK to 500,000 SEK.

Q: How long does a kitchen renovation take?

A: The duration of a kitchen renovation depends on the scope of the project. A simple renovation such as replacing cabinets and countertops can take a few days to a week, while a more complex renovation that involves structural changes and plumbing work can take several weeks or even months.

Q: Can I renovate my kitchen myself?

A: While it’s possible to renovate your kitchen yourself, it’s not recommended unless you have experience in carpentry, plumbing, and electrical work. A poorly executed renovation can not only be costly but also pose safety hazards. Therefore, it’s best to hire a professional contractor who has the expertise and equipment to do the job right.
